Conventional employing processes are frequently slow, costly, and constrained by local skill accessibility. Offshore skill acquisition helps eliminate these restraints by supplying access to a more comprehensive swimming pool of skilled experts who are prepared to support remote operations.

Administrative coordination, customer support, sales operations, bookkeeping, marketing execution, data organization, and executive assistance are regularly performed by remote experts working within structured systems. With established partnership tools and safe and secure platforms, offshore virtual assistants integrate into day-to-day operations with consistency and accountability, permitting necessary work to continue without interruption. Speed is one of the most useful advantages of this approach.

Offshore staffing suppliers decrease these delays by preserving pre-screened skill pools. Prospects are assessed for skills, communication capability, and reliability before being matched with service requirements. This allows companies to move from recognizing a requirement to onboarding support even more effectively than standard recruitment approaches. Offshore talent acquisition represents a tactical approach to recruitment where business employ certified professionals from global places outside their home country. This hiring method has become essential for businesses seeking to broaden their labor force while preserving functional performance and handling acquisition costs efficiently. The overseas recruitment process includes determining, screening, and onboarding remote workers or professionals from different countries and time zones.
